Output eda4fca64014e807af5b5f1b5c88fa89093f8667125fb8fcfa20af362cd000f7:27

value
2480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ed334fdaa7fdf8953193924395ccf61cb479918 OP_EQUAL
address
3GAohmkDqEGdGsSb1YiBEBLGFH1zBarcXF
transaction
eda4fca64014e807af5b5f1b5c88fa89093f8667125fb8fcfa20af362cd000f7
spent
true